Abstract

An estimation apparatus according to an embodiment of the present disclosure includes a memory and a hardware processor coupled to the memory. The hardware processor is configured to: acquire first point cloud data; generate, from the first point cloud data, second point cloud data in which an attention point and at least one observation point are combined, the attention point gaining attention as a target of attribute estimation; and estimate an attribute of the attention point by calculating, for each attribute, a belonging probability of belonging to the attribute by using the second point cloud data.
